Common Types of Old Insulation and Their Risks
Before beginning the removal process, it is important to identify the type of insulation in place. Different insulation materials pose different risks and require specific handling techniques.
1. Fiberglass Insulation
Fiberglass insulation is one of the most common types found in homes and buildings. While it is non-toxic, its fibers can irritate the skin, eyes, and respiratory system. Proper protective gear is necessary when handling this material.
2. Cellulose Insulation
Made from recycled paper products, cellulose insulation can degrade over time and may harbor mold or pests. If exposed to moisture, it can become a fire hazard or release allergens into the air.
3. Asbestos-Based Insulation
Some older homes in Lee, NV, may contain asbestos insulation, which is highly hazardous when disturbed. If asbestos is suspected, professional assistance is mandatory to ensure safe removal and disposal.
4. Spray Foam Insulation
Older spray foam insulation may contain chemicals that degrade over time, releasing volatile organic compounds (VOCs). Proper ventilation and protective measures are required when removing this type of insulation.
Steps for Safe Old Insulation Removal
1. Assess the Condition and Type of Insulation
Before starting, conduct a thorough inspection to determine the type of insulation and any potential hazards. If asbestos is present, contact a specialist for professional removal.
2. Gather the Necessary Protective Equipment
Safety is paramount when handling old insulation. The following protective gear should be used:
-
Disposable coveralls
-
N95 or higher-rated respirator mask
-
Safety goggles
-
Heavy-duty gloves
3. Seal Off the Work Area
To prevent the spread of airborne particles, seal the workspace using plastic sheeting and tape. This is particularly important in residential settings where insulation fibers can contaminate living spaces.
4. Remove the Insulation Carefully
The method of removal depends on the type of insulation:
-
Fiberglass: Gently roll up batts and place them in sealed bags.
-
Cellulose: Use a high-powered vacuum with a HEPA filter.
-
Spray Foam: Cut and scrape the material carefully, minimizing airborne particles.
-
Asbestos: Only certified professionals should handle this material.
5. Proper Disposal Methods
Old insulation must be disposed of according to local regulations in Lee, NV. Some insulation types can be taken to designated landfills, while hazardous materials require specialized disposal services.
6. Clean and Inspect the Area
After insulation removal, thoroughly clean the area with a HEPA vacuum and disinfect surfaces. Inspect for any structural damage or mold that may need remediation before installing new insulation.

Best Practices for Installing New Insulation
After removing old insulation, installing high-quality insulation is key to improving energy efficiency. The best options for Lee, NV, include:
-
Spray Foam Insulation – Provides superior thermal resistance and air sealing.
-
Fiberglass Batts – Cost-effective and widely used in residential settings.
-
Blown-In Cellulose – Ideal for attics and enclosed spaces.
Choosing the right insulation ensures better indoor comfort and lower energy costs in the long run.

FAQs
1. How do I know if my old insulation needs to be removed?
Signs that indicate the need for removal include visible damage, mold growth, pest infestations, and reduced energy efficiency.
2. Can I remove the old insulation myself?
DIY removal is possible for non-hazardous materials like fiberglass, but professionals should handle asbestos or severely contaminated insulation.
3. What should I do if my insulation contains asbestos?
Contact a licensed asbestos removal specialist immediately. Do not attempt to remove or disturb the insulation.
4. How is old insulation disposed of in Lee, NV?
Disposal regulations vary by material. Fiberglass and cellulose can go to local landfills, while hazardous materials require special handling.
5. How long does insulation removal take?
The timeline depends on the insulation type and project size. Small projects take a day, while larger or hazardous removals may take several days.
6. What are the health risks of old insulation?
Health risks include respiratory issues, skin irritation, and exposure to hazardous substances like asbestos or mold.
7. Is it necessary to replace insulation after removal?
Yes, replacing insulation improves energy efficiency, indoor comfort, and overall building performance.
8. What is the best insulation for homes in Lee, NV?
Spray foam and fiberglass are highly effective due to their thermal properties and resistance to temperature fluctuations.
9. How much does insulation removal cost?
Costs vary based on insulation type, contamination level, and project size. Contacting a professional for an estimate is recommended.
10. Can insulation removal improve indoor air quality?
Yes, removing old or contaminated insulation reduces allergens, mold spores, and airborne irritants, leading to better indoor air quality.
